Tradition has it that Isaiah was murdered by being sawn in two by Manasseh when he was an old man after having lived through the reigns of 4 kings from 739-686BC but dates of his birth and death are unknown [From John MacArthur's Notes on Isaiah in his Study Bible].
Isaiah lived until at least 701 B.C. According to Jewish tradition, Isaiah died by being sawn in half during the reign of the evil king Manasseh of Judah.
